48-3402. Rights and powers of district

A. Irrigation water delivery districts shall be bodies corporate for the purposes specified in this chapter and shall have the rights, privileges and powers conferred by law, but the districts shall not be considered municipal corporations.

B. The district shall have perpetual succession, and may:

1. Exercise the power of eminent domain.

2. Contract and be contracted with.

3. Sue and be sued in its corporate name.

4. Acquire, hold and dispose of, for the benefit of the district, all real and personal property which is necessary or useful in the conduct of its business.

5. Adopt a seal.

6. Provide by contract with any irrigation project, or United States reclamation project, for the performance of any service which it is authorized by this chapter to perform.

7. Do all things lawful and reasonably useful in carrying out the purposes of this chapter.
